A few TK members have hit the nail on the head .. it’s a very simple game, to win you need aggressive metre eater mongrel props that dominate up front.

You need big bodied fast mobile centres and outside backs that run hard hurt in tackles & don’t get rag dolled.

You need a skilled 1 6 7 9 spine that have played a bit of footy together ..

Most importantly, that 7 needs to run the team & be a game manager, your 7 needs to have the running game, passing game, and the kicking skills to keep the team on the front foot and the opposition under pressure, your 7 allows every other player especially the 1 and 6 to inject their skills into the game.

Run your eye over our team and ask yourself how many of those boxes do we tick, and there’s your answer, that’s why we’ve started the season in 17th place.
